Alison was always energetic since she was a baby; cheerful and tireless. She loved to play, share and be free. It was during her teen years that a virus changed everything. Her days as a flute player and judoka were put on hold indefinitely. Alison was diagnosed with Myalgic Encephalomyelitis (ME) and two years ago she was diagnosed with Multiple Chemical Sensitivity (MCS).

Myalgic Encephalomyelitis is a complex neuroimmune disease that affects all body systems. Whereas Multiple Chemical Sensitivity means super sensitivity to chemicals and toxins, as your body is continually storing toxins. This diagnosis has progressed and is currently in the severe stage. On the other hand, her immune system is severely compromised. Her illness worsened after Hurricane María due to the prolonged exposure to electric generators used by neighbors, and the environmental pollution at that time.

Every day Alison is affected by pollutants, environmental factors, and other aggravating factors around her home and surroundings, such as: car fumes, pesticides, paint, gases, electric generators, trimmers, gas stations, pressure washers, among others. This daily exposure deteriorates her health and causes strong symptoms of nausea, dizziness, tachycardia, pain throughout the body, intolerances to light, noise, touch, taste and flavor, etc. The most dangerous of these diseases are autonomic dysfunctions, with cognitive/motor loss, and often losing the sense of reality.
